    How well does having a pool in Florida when it rains so much? Is there a lot of overflow? Any concerns of water getting into the homes?
    Love how informative you guys are thank you:)

    • @SoldByChenkus
      @SoldByChenkus  3 роки тому +1

      Thanks Jessica! Rainy season can cause some overflow on pools, but they all have drains for overflow or valves that help with this issue. And if they don't there is a way to add one to the pool! The water usually has a long way to go and has to go over the drain on the Lanai to even get close to the house, so that is not really a concern. Good question!

    What type of pool is the way to go? Concrete, fiberglass, liner?? I dont seem to see many liner pools in Floroda (correct me if I'm wrong)....

    • @SoldByChenkus
      @SoldByChenkus  3 роки тому +2

      The majority of the pools in this area are going to be concrete with varying finishes. This gives you the most options in customizing the pool and lasts the longest. Fiberglass can be cheaper but limited on size & style. Vinyl is the cheapest but needs to be replaced more often, which could get costly. Concrete would be my suggestion! :)
